Romero

Romero

In defense of the poor in El Salvador, he fought with the only weapon he had... the truth.

Released PG-13 105 min 7.1/10 Votes: 2475
Romero is a compelling and deeply moving look at the life of Archbishop Oscar Romero of El Salvador, who made the ultimate sacrifice in a passionate stand against social injustice and oppression in his county. This film chronicles the transformation of Romero from an apolitical, complacent priest to a committed leader of the Salvadoran people.
